Why Commercial Real Estate Investment Instead of Residential?

The fact is, there are many advantages to real estate over other investment vehicles. Stocks can plummet, precious metals are precarious at best, and futures are just a huge risk. But real estate is tangible. And, it’s track record is undeniably strong. But, why choose commercial real estate over residential as an investment? Well, there are a few good reasons. First and foremost is residential centers around a single tenant. (That’s cause for alarm because the rent relies on one individual.)

Many people start out investing in residential real estate simply because they’re more accustomed to buying homes, but commercial real estate can be a great way to balance your portfolio. You just need to bone up on the different rules and terms in the commercial market. —Entrepreneur.com

Second, financing residential real estate that’s not a primary residence is a nightmare. Because you must not only pledge collateral, you’re putting your own home at risk. Third, resale is actually less stressful. Simply put, multifamily attracts more buyers. But also, it attracts serious buyers. Plus, it’s larger so it’s inherently more valuable.

Commercial Real Estate Investment Benefits You should Know About

Now, there are more commercial real estate investment benefits and some also juxtapose residential properties. Here are three compelling reasons to take advantage of multifamily property investing:

  • Larger income potential. When you own a residential property, you have one rental income. But, when you invest in commercial, multifamily housing, you have many tenants. Hense, you have a larger income streaming in, month after month. Sure, you’ll have some short-term vacancies here and there but there will still be others paying rent.
  • Bigger equity gains. Of course, with a larger piece of property on a bigger land footprint, you’ll have a bigger equity gain. Every year that passes just adds to its value. What’s more, it also adds to the local micro-economy. What’s more, there are always more tenants which means a steady revenue stream, which causes principal pay down. That too, adds to equity.
  • Hard, tangible assets. Investing in commercial means that you have hard assets in your portfolio. Which means you have increased leverage to use to acquire more properties or a stake in other commercial properties to add to your income.
